Preclinical In Vitro Model to Assess the Changes in Permeability and Cytotoxicity of Polarized Intestinal Epithelial Cells during Exposure Mimicking Oral or Intravenous Routes: An Example of Arsenite Exposure. Parajuli P, Gokulan K, Khare S. International Journal of Molecular Sciences. 2022 May, 23(9), 4851. 10.3390/ijms23094851
Chemicals and drugs can cause different effects on the gut health based on whether they are given by shot in the vein (intravenous exposure) or as a pill that is swallowed (oral exposure). The authors used intestinal cells in culture and found they could assess the difference in the gut barrier function due to the exposure route. This preclinical in vitro model will reduce the use of animals for testing the impact of exposure route.

IVIVE: Facilitating the Use of In Vitro Toxicity Data in Risk Assessment and Decision Making, Chang X, Tan YM, Allen DG, Bell S, Brown PC, Browning L, Ceger P, Gearhart J, Hakkinen PJ, Kabadi SV, Kleinstreuer NC, Lumen A, Matheson J, Paini A, Pangburn HA, Petersen EJ, Reinke EN, Ribeiro AJS, Sipes N, Sweeney LM, Wambaugh JF, Wange R, Wetmore BA, Mumtaz M., Toxics 2022, 10(5), 232; 10.3390/toxics10050232
This publication is a compilation of ideas and opinions of scientists from different organizations, including regulatory agencies from across the world, on using alternatives to traditional animal research to evaluate the safety of diverse types of chemicals, such as drugs, food substances, and environmental chemicals. It also highlights challenges and offers suggestions to overcome those challenges involved in use of these newer methods.
